These functions access the automatically updated lists provided by trakt.tv. Each function comes in two flavors: Shows or movies. The following descriptions are adapted directly from the API reference.
Popular: Popularity is calculated using the rating percentage and the number of ratings.
Trending: Returns all movies/shows being watched right now. Movies/shows with the most users are returned first.
Played: Returns the most played (a single user can watch multiple times)
movies/shows in the specified time period
.
Watched: Returns the most watched (unique users) movies/shows in the specified
time period
.
Collected: Returns the most collected (unique users) movies/shows in the
specified time period
.
Anticipated: Returns the most anticipated movies/shows based on the number of
lists a movie/show appears on.
The functions for Played, Watched, Collected and Played each return
the same additional variables besides the media information: watcher_count
,
play_count
, collected_count
, collector_count
.
